Cardinals Vs. Astros Preview: St. Louis Looks For Second Win In 8 Games

After a tough loss on Tuesday, the St. Louis Cardinals once again face up against the Houston Astros on Wednesday night in a battle of NL Central teams. Having lost six of their past seven games, the Cardinals are hoping that Adam Wainwright can help to get the team back on track.

Returning from Tommy John surgery, consistency has been an obvious issue for Wainwright in the early part of the 2012 campaign. In his most recent start on June 1, he allowed seven runs over 6.1 innings against the Mets, but his preceding two starts consisted of 15 innings of one-run ball, including a shutout of the Padres.

At one point, the Cardinals were sitting pretty with a 20-11 record, but things have fallen apart since then. Over their past 25 games, St. Louis has posted a brutal 8-17 record, dropping into third place in the division.
